Output c2a6fa5e64f43ad5d89019a7661526b10cdeb1a8f6a440b66eecd012112d0729:4

value
43594394
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 63f0ed88c8ca5b90bb2bc5634eb78a7fb6a7021c OP_EQUALVERIFY OP_CHECKSIG
address
1A7SWxGps2Uk4Yy6jYSHu1CLdEuQbCUxZU
transaction
c2a6fa5e64f43ad5d89019a7661526b10cdeb1a8f6a440b66eecd012112d0729
confirmations
431893
spent
true